1. Optimize Your Google My Business (GMB) Listing

90% of local searches begin on Google. Your Google My Business listing is literally your digital storefront, it's often the first contact a potential customer has with your business.

How to Optimize Your GMB Listing

  • Complete all sections: hours, professional photos, service list, service area. A complete listing is 7x more likely to attract clicks.
  • Encourage customer reviews and respond to every single one, positive and negative. Reviews are a major ranking factor in local SEO.
  • Use local keywords in your description: 'Montreal plumber,' 'Quebec City restaurant,' 'Laval cleaning.'
  • Post regularly with Google Posts (offers, events, news) to signal to Google that your business is active.

4. Launch Geo-Targeted Advertising

If SEO is a marathon, advertising is a sprint. Both are complementary and form the pillars of a complete local strategy.

Facebook & Instagram Ads

  • Target a 5 to 20 km radius around your business
  • Use lookalike audiences based on your best customers
  • Test visuals with recognizable local landmarks (monuments, streets, landscapes)

Google Ads

  • Target keywords like 'near me,' 'in [city],' 'emergency [service]'
  • Enable location and call extensions to maximize conversions
  • With a budget of $200 to $500/month, you can achieve significant results

Frequently asked questions

How long does it take to see results with local marketing?

Local SEO typically takes 3 to 6 months for significant results, while geo-targeted advertising can generate results in just a few weeks.

What budget should you plan for starting local marketing?

A budget of $200 to $500 per month is a good starting point to combine advertising and content. Google My Business optimization is entirely free.

How do you measure the effectiveness of local strategies?

Track local searches in Google Analytics, the number of calls and direction requests from your GMB listing, and the conversion rate of your landing pages.

Do you need to be on every social media platform?

No. Facebook and Instagram are sufficient for the vast majority of local SMBs in Quebec. Focus your efforts on the platforms where your customers are actually active.
